Subject: | Disfigured bill on sulphur-crested cockatoo at Lyneham |
From: | Alison <> |
Date: | Sun, 15 Jul 2018 09:27:27 +0000 |
I spotted this bird near the Lyneham wetlands pond. Its bill seems to be in three parts. The top part looks like the what should have been the top part of the bill, but below it is a second top bill, which has a distorted growth growing straight outwards. Alison Milton Attachment:
